Transaction e9510e1e8dd71669251409274da54f5a36ec89750601c3d1430a14de7d87f272
1 Input
1 Output
-
e9510e1e8dd71669251409274da54f5a36ec89750601c3d1430a14de7d87f272:0
- value
- 2822436
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a7ff977ce73b5f3385a15723a73d1e52e7780bf OP_EQUAL
- address
- 3Crjfmcwg9csmTWwCp32aq2bhMwTp7jCzs